Toxicants are harmful substances that can cause adverse effects on living organisms, including humans, animals, and plants, when they are absorbed or ingested. Examples of toxicants include heavy metals like lead and Mercury, pesticides such as DDT, and industrial chemicals like benzene and asbestos. These substances can lead to various health issues, ranging from acute poisoning to long-term chronic conditions. Additionally, toxicants can impact ecosystems, causing harm to wildlife and disrupting ecological balance.

An abiotic toxicant is a chemical or substance that can harm living organisms or the environment, but is not derived from living organisms itself. Examples include heavy metals, certain pesticides, and industrial pollutants. These toxicants can have harmful effects on ecosystems and human health.
